Is there a way to request HTTPS-only API response contents? This means that when I request user/dashboard, all URLs in the response - Photos, Audio embed code, Video embed code, etc. - are HTTPS instead of HTTP. If I use these URLs in an HTTPS page it won't result in errors in browser console such as (Chrome browser example):

  The page at https://somesecure.com/page displayed insecure content from http://someinsecure.com/content

Nope, we currently don't have a functionality like that.

Most sites that display content from external domains have similar warnings for the
user when browsing under HTTPS.  Not all external domains support https.
